Mycotic aneurysm of the inferior mesenteric artery
American Journal of Surgery
|September 1, 1979
Abstract:
This is the first reported case of successful management of a mycotic aneurysm of the inferior mesenteric artery. The only helpful clinical manifestations were episodes of previous abdominal pain and a history of bacterial endocarditis. The surgical management involved simple excision without revascularization of the inferior mesenteric artery.
